Dumpster Size Alternatives



For selecting the best dumpster dimension, it's essential to have a mutual understanding of the offered alternatives. Dumpster dimensions normally vary from 10 to 40 cubic yards, with variations in between.

A 10-yard dumpster appropriates for tiny jobs like a garage cleanout or a tiny restoration. If you're tackling a medium-sized task such as a cooking area remodel or a basement cleanout, a 20-yard dumpster might be the right selection.

For larger jobs like a whole-house remodelling or commercial construction, a 30 or 40-yard dumpster could be better to accommodate the quantity of waste produced.

When selecting a dumpster dimension, take into consideration the amount and sort of debris you anticipate to get rid of. For larger projects like remodeling numerous rooms or removing a large estate, a 20-yard dumpster may be preferable. These are around 22 feet long and can hold roughly 8 pickup tons.

If you're dealing with a major building task or business remodelling, a 30-yard dumpster could be the most effective fit. These dumpsters have to do with 22 feet long and can suit regarding 12 pickup tons of particles.



Matching the dumpster size to your task ensures you have adequate room for all waste materials without overpaying for unused capability.
